The FERM domain of human moesin with a bound peptide identified by phage display
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| DIAMOND BEAMLINE I03 |
Synchrotron site | Diamond |
Beamline | I03 |
Temperature [K] | 100 |
Detector technology | PIXEL |
Collection date | 2022-04-14 |
Detector | DECTRIS EIGER2 XE 16M |
Wavelength(s) | 0.9763 |
Spacegroup name | P 1 21 1 |
Unit cell lengths | 45.466, 155.391, 63.607 |
Unit cell angles | 90.00, 94.28, 90.00 |
Refinement procedure
Resolution | 77.696 - 1.850 |
Rwork | 0.178 |
R-free | 0.24080 |
Structure solution method | MOLECULAR REPLACEMENT |
RMSD bond length | 0.011 |
RMSD bond angle | 1.635 |
Data reduction software | DIALS |
Data scaling software | Aimless |
Phasing software | PHASER |
Refinement software | REFMAC (5.8.0352)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 77.700 | 1.890 |
High resolution limit [Å] | 1.850 | 1.850 |
Number of reflections | 74812 | 4621 |
<I/σ(I)> | 7.8 | 0.9 |
Completeness [%] | 100.0 | 99.6 |
Redundancy | 13.2 | |
CC(1/2) | 0.997 | 0.347 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P | 7.5 | 277 | 200 mM sodium bromide, 100 mM bis-tris-propane, 10% ethylene glycol, 20% PEG3350 |
